Report: Tail Light Wiring in Cargo Area May be Damaged
Chevrolet Express 2500 Problem
15 Reports
Model Years Affected: 1996, 1997, 1998, 1999, 2000, 2001, 2002, 2003, 2004, 2005, 2006, 2007
Average Mileage: 91,789 mi (70,000 mi - 105,000 mi)
Verified
The tail light wiring harness in the cargo area is not protected very well. As a result it may become damaged due to normal wear a tear. This damage can causing some or all of the rear lights to stop working.
